Echosystems is the final degree show for the MA/MFA Computational Arts programme at Goldsmiths, University of London.
The exhibition features ground-breaking immersive performances, interactive installations, virtual and augmented realities, and thought-provoking conceptual works by mixed disciplinary artists from fields as diverse as physics, dance, fine art, sound art, photography, biology, graphic design and puppetry.
Echosystems explores themes including digital ecologies, speculative futures, storytelling, embodiment and computational explorations of physical space, nurturing new ways of understanding human and machine agency, reimagining human-computer interaction.
